pardon my ignorance, but what's the difference between divacup and keeper? it looks pretty much the same to me.

Divacup is made of medical grade silicone, and Keeper is made of gum rubber. The shape not appreciably different. I only have the divacup, but as far as I've heard, they are the same for most intents and purposes.

Diva Cup (in comparison to a tampax super tampon)

Made of silicone (great for those allergic to latex), has a shorter stem and a measuring lable inside the cup to track your flow. Also, it comes with it's own cloth bag and Diva pin. The DivaCup has a one year money back satisfaction guarantee from date of purchase (minus the cost of the original shipping, if applicable). cost = 25.50 + 2.95 S&H (US)

The Keeper

Made of rubber and has a very long stem that, from using the Diva Cup, I would say would need to be trimmed to be comfortable. Also comes with a cloth bag. 3 MONTH MONEY BACK GUARANTEE. cost = 35.00 plus S&H
